ELMIRA, New York, Jan. 31 -- The New York State United Teachers issued the following news release on Jan. 30:
New York State United Teachers is visiting schools in the Southern Tier and Mohawk Valley to draw attention to the severe impact a lack of state funding has had on schools statewide. Union activists are also highlighting the need for new revenues that will enable the state to tackle educational inequality, and other pressing needs.
